Commercial Aquafeed Market Growth Driven by Aquaculture Expansion
The global seafood industry is experiencing a significant transformation toward sustainable aquaculture, with the Commercial Aquafeed Market emerging as a key enabler of this protein revolution. As per the market report, the aquafeed market is projected to reach USD 97.12 billion by 2031 from USD 67.71 billion in 2026, at a CAGR of 7.5% .
The rising demand for aquafeed has fundamentally reshaped the aquaculture nutrition landscape, moving beyond traditional feeding methods toward scientifically developed, species-specific formulations. The growth of the aquafeed market is driven by an increase in demand for seafood and innovations in aquaculture technologies . The Asia Pacific region is estimated to account for 63.7% of the aquafeed market in 2026, driven by China, a major producer of aquafeed .
Aquaculture producers are increasingly adopting functional feeds, sustainable feed ingredients, alternative protein sources, and precision feeding technologies to improve productivity while reducing environmental impact and dependence on traditional fishmeal resources . The fishmeal segment is estimated to dominate the market with a share of 27.3% in 2026, while the dry form segment is projected to witness the highest CAGR of 7.8% . Expanding aquaculture activities, increasing global seafood consumption, and advancements in feed formulation technologies are creating substantial growth opportunities . FAQ 1: What ingredients are used in commercial aquafeed?
Aquafeed ingredients include soybean, corn, fishmeal, fish oil, and additives such as vitamins, minerals, and feed enzymes.
FAQ 2: Which region dominates the commercial aquafeed market?
Asia Pacific accounts for 63.7% of the market, driven by China's position as a major producer of aquafeed.
